Birmingham New Street to Berkswell by train

A train trip from Birmingham New Street to Berkswell takes about 18 mins on average, covering roughly 12 miles (19 kilometres). With around 37 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£2.90,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Amenities

Birmingham New Street is open and ready to cater to all of your travel needs. The ticket office operates extensive hours, opening from 5:15 AM to 11 PM on weekdays and 8 AM to 11 PM on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ets at a time that suits you. Remember to bring your online purchase collection codes to use the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a top priority, with step-free access throughout the station, elevators and escalators serving all platforms, and dedicated staff available for assistance. However, note that accessible ticket machines are not available.

If you're in need of some refreshments or a shopping fix, you’re in luck. With a variety of food and drink outlets ranging from Costa Coffee to M&S Food and The Pasty Shop, you won't go hungry. For those looking to stay connected, public Wi-Fi is available across the station, making it easy for you to work or catch up on your favorite shows while waiting. There's also CCTV coverage providing enhanced security throughout the premise.

Onward Travel Connections

Ready to explore beyond Birmingham? New Street's strategic location offers myriad transport links to let you do just that. Taxis can be picked up from Navigation Street, while nearby bus stops on Smallbrook Queensway and Hill Street provide plentiful options to get you where you need to go. Most buses are wheelchair accessible, ensuring a seamless journey for everyone. Additionally, the Midland Metro tram network, easily accessible from the station, offers a swift way to get around the city.

If flying's on your itinerary, there's a regular train service to Birmingham International Airport, just a brief 10-15 minute ride away. Facilities at Berkswell Station

Berkswell Station, while not the largest or most equipped, offers essential facilities to meet the needs of its passengers. For purchasing tickets, travelers can visit the ticket office during limited hours throughout the week—be sure to catch it open from 7:00 AM to 1:00 PM on weekdays, although Fridays and Saturdays offer expanded hours. Alternatively, there are ticket machines available to purchase or collect tickets bought online. However, keep in mind that no accessible ticket machines are present, and for those with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available.

While the station lacks amenities such as refreshment facilities, waiting rooms, or accessible toilets, passengers can find comfort in the seating areas provided. Accessibility is partially catered for with step-free access classified under category B1, meaning users should anticipate ramps and street-crossing for platform interchange.
